Decorative cushions adjust the visual weight of seating areas. They soften outlines and introduce layering without altering furniture placement. On sofas, chairs, or beds, cushions influence how a space is read, more structured or more relaxed. Their scale affects posture and spacing, while their arrangement guides the eye across a surface. Cushions also allow subtle shifts in tone across a room, linking different areas without repetition. Used sparingly, they clarify rather than clutter. Their value lies in how they redefine volume and proportion within an existing layout.
